What Is a Brain-Computer Interface?
Brain-computer interfaces (BCIs) allow users to control devices using their thoughts by translating brain signals into digital commands. BCIs provide a non-muscular communication channel and facilitate the acquisition, manipulation, analysis, and translation of brain signals to control external devices or applications. Their applications involve restoring speech and mobility, aiding stroke recovery, and even controlling smart homes or robotic limbs. The BCI market is rapidly emerging as one of the most revolutionary sectors, impacting areas such as gaming and entertainment, security and authentication, healthcare, education, advertising, neuromarketing, and neuroergonomics.
How is AI Revolutionizing the Brain Computer Interface Market?
AI plays a critical role in revolutionizing the brain computer interface market. The brain-computer interface developers have started integrating artificial intelligence into their systems for decoding complex brain signals, filtering noise, interpreting user intent, and controlling external devices. Moreover, AI enhances neurorehabilitation and improves cognitive functions in human beings.
- In March 2025, Synchron, a leading brain-computer interface (BCI) company, unveiled Chiral, a foundation model of human cognition, introducing Cognitive AI. The company is advancing BCI from supervised to self-supervised learning, leveraging large-scale neural data and NVIDIA AI-powered computing to accelerate development.

Why Did the Non-Invasive Segment Dominate the Brain Computer Interface Market in 2025?
The non-invasive brain computer interface segment held the largest market share due to its healthcare and rehabilitation demand. Non-invasive brain computer interfaces measure electrical activity from the scalp, making them safer and more accessible than their invasive counterparts. Non-invasive BCIs are advantageous for their ease of use and lower risk, as they avoid the complications related to surgery. Advancements in signal processing and machine learning continually enhance the performance of non-invasive BCIs.
The invasive segment is expected to grow at the fastest rate during the forecast period due to its accuracy and high signal resolution. As the electrodes are in direct contact with the brain, they are able to capture detailed neural activity, enabling more precise control of external devices. Due to this, the invasive segment promises to precisely decode motor intentions, making it suitable for motor-impaired patients.

Components Insights
Which Component of Brain Computer Interface Dominated the Market in 2025?
The software segment dominated the brain-computer interface market in 2025, due to its importance in processing and interpreting brain signals captured by the hardware. Software is a vital part of brain-computer interfaces. It utilizes algorithms and artificial intelligence to analyze brain activities and convert them into control signals for various applications. Furthermore, users from multiple research areas have adopted BCI software to investigate various concepts.
The hardware segment is anticipated to grow with the highest CAGR during the forecast period because hardware is a device that develops a direct communication pathway between your brain and an external device, like a computer. BCI hardware records signals from the brain, either invasively or non-invasively, using a series of device parts. This involves electrodes, neural signal processors, amplifiers, wireless transmitters, and wearable EEG headsets. In addition, the evolution toward compact, wireless, and wearable devices is the main segment growth driver as consumers and clinics both want devices that are portable, comfortable, and easy to use.

China Brain Interface Computer Market Trends
The China BCI landscape is undergoing a significant transformation, emerging as a formidable force in this technology sector. In August 2025, multiple Chinese authorities issued guidelines to promote the innovative development of the BCI industry, aiming for key technological breakthroughs by 2027. In June 2026, China approved NEO, the world's first commercially cleared invasive brain implant, designed to assist specific patients with paralysis caused by spinal cord injuries in regaining movement and performing everyday tasks.
Europe Brain Interface Computer Market Trends
Europe is also expected to experience significant growth in the brain-computer interface market, driven by the rising prevalence of neurological disorders and enhanced healthcare infrastructure. There are currently 77 BCI startups in Europe, including MindMaze, Cumulus Neuro, CoMind, Inria, and CorTec. Among these, 40 startups have received funding, with 14 securing Series A+ funding, and one achieving unicorn status. These companies are developing brain-computer interfaces for specific applications such as healthcare, fitness and wellness, gaming and entertainment, communication, and control.
Germany Brain Interface Computer Market Trends
Germany's brain-computer interface market is rapidly growing, driven by technological advancements, increased research funding, and rising demand for medical and consumer applications. As the regional population ages, there is an urgent need for advanced neuroprosthetics and rehabilitation tools that restore motor function. In July 2025, CorTec GmbH, a pioneer in active implantable medical technologies, declared the first human implantation of its proprietary BCI system, Brain Interchange™, marking a significant milestone in translating laboratory research into real-world clinical applications.
